Flame Retardants for Most Applications Using the vast natural resource of bromine and minerals in the Dead Sea, ICL-IP produces a series of highquality flame retardant products, applicable to a wide range of plastics, polymers and polymer alloys. ICLIP also offers the world’s most comprehensive range of phosphorus-based flame retardants, fire resistant plasticizers and hydraulic fluids for high demanding applications. Bromine- and Phosphorus-based flame retardants are considered as the two most efficient FR families, and in fact, constitute approximately 55% (in value) of total FR usage. ICL–IP’s portfolio also includes a few additional non-halogen- and nonphosphorus-based FRs such as high purity grades of Magnesium Hydroxide and Melamine Cyanurate. Polymeric Flame Retardants for Sustainability Polymeric flame retardants are sustainable products in accordance with many national and international human health and environmental regulations. They have long been recognized as the safest and most “elegant” flame retardants of high molecular weight man-made materials. Non-leaching Due to their low solubility in water, polymeric flame retardants, once incorporated into the end-product plastic matrix, become integrated with the plastic and leaching is not expected to occur. Non-bio-accumulative Their high molecular weight makes them unlikely to penetrate through the cell membranes of living tissues. Non-blooming Furthermore, they do not migrate to the surface of the plastic during aging, thus eliminating any potential blooming in the finished product. ICL-IP is promoting several ranges of brominated polymeric flame retardants for most applications: • FR-1025: brominated polyacrylate • F-2000 series: brominated epoxy polymers with a wide range of molecular weight • F-3000 series: end-capped brominated epoxy polymers with various molecular weights • FR-803P: brominated polystyrene • FR-122P: Brominated butadiene / styrene block copolymer. Expanded and extruded polystyrene foams for building, construction and packaging industries are available in many forms: Sheets (thermal insulation), Profiles (decorative), Molded shapes (packaging).
